The Adirondack Chair:
Twenty-seven years ago I worked in the Emergency Department at UBC Hospital.
Dr Fleming was part of an amazing group of people who worked there at that time.
One day I decided I wanted an Adirondack Chair and bought myself a "kit".
Big mistake. After months of agony I admitted to the group that the "kit" was still in pieces on my floor. I couldn´t figure out the "plan" that came with the "kit".
Bruce calmly turned to me and said: "bring it in. We´ll see what we can do"
So one night when all the patients had left we tackled the chair. I remember a lot of activity and drilling.
I also remember walking out with the chair as the sun rose.
The back of the picture said: Bruce, Carol and Carol.
UBC ER April 1995. 4:00:am!
I still have the chair.
Thank you UBC ER and Dr Fleming for showing me early on what team work, collaboration and caring looks like.
It´s something I´ve never forgot.
